Peoria, IL – Man Arrested After Barricade and Chemical Munitions Deployment

Peoria, IL – A Peoria man was arrested following a standoff with police on the 1100 block of S. Blaine Street.

According to the Peoria Police Department, officers arrived around 1:00 p.m. in response to a report of trouble with a man. The suspect, identified as 52-year-old Matthew J. Burnside Jr., barricaded himself inside his residence, allegedly armed with a rifle. SWAT and negotiators were called to the scene to convince Burnside to surrender. When he refused, chemical munitions were deployed. Burnside was then taken into custody without further incident.

Police executed a search warrant and found a .22 rifle. Burnside faces multiple charges, including an IDOC Warrant for parole violation, unlawful use of a weapon by a felon, and resisting arrest. He is also wanted for domestic battery and criminal damage to property. He is currently held at Peoria County Jail.
